Episode 1 - S14.E1 - Top Gear

William Woollard finds out just how much 'blood, sweat and tears' is needed to build your own kit car and looks at the way in which the British component car industry is cleaning up its cowboy image. For more than 20 years Allan Garland has lavished great care and attention on the exhibits in Vauxhall's own motor museum at Luton. Now he's retiring as curator and Sue Baker spent a day with Allan and some of the cars he has loved for so long. And Frank Page drives through the Yorkshire Dales to find out how Fiat's new Uno Turbo shapes up against the opposition.
